How Can You Ensure Optimal Performance Through Proper Maintenance of a Single Seat ATV?

To ensure optimal performance through proper maintenance of a single seat ATV, consider the following key practices:

  • Regular Oil Changes: Changing the oil regularly is crucial for maintaining the engine’s health and performance. Fresh oil lubricates the engine parts, reduces friction, and helps prevent overheating, which can lead to engine damage.
  • Tire Maintenance: Keeping tires properly inflated and treaded ensures better traction and handling. Regularly check for wear and tear and rotate tires as needed to prolong their lifespan and enhance safety.
  • Air Filter Cleaning/Replacement: A clean air filter is essential for optimal engine performance as it allows for proper airflow. Clogged or dirty filters can reduce power and fuel efficiency, so regular inspection and replacement are necessary.
  • Battery Care: Checking the battery’s charge and connections helps prevent starting issues. Regularly cleaning the terminals and ensuring tight connections can extend battery life and reliability during rides.
  • Brake System Checks: Ensuring that the brake fluid is at the correct level and inspecting pads for wear is vital for safety. Effective brakes are essential for handling and stopping the ATV, particularly in challenging terrains.
  • Suspension Maintenance: Inspecting and maintaining the suspension system is important for comfort and control. Regularly check for any leaks in shock absorbers and ensure that all components are functioning correctly to provide a smooth ride.
  • Chain and Sprocket Inspection: For ATVs with chain drives, regular inspection and lubrication of the chain are necessary to avoid excessive wear. Proper tension and alignment of the chain and sprockets contribute to efficient power transfer and longevity.
  • Fuel System Maintenance: Using high-quality fuel and regularly inspecting fuel lines can prevent clogging and engine performance issues. Keeping the fuel system clean ensures that the engine runs smoothly and efficiently, reducing the chance of breakdowns.
